Bangladesh coach Simmons wary of wounded Australia in second test
Bangladesh coach Phil Simmons has warned his players to expect a fierce backlash from Australia in the second test after his side shocked the cricket world with a nine-wicket, opens new tab victory in the series opener in Darwin.
